Jennifer graduated from University College Dublin with a BCL Honours Degree in 2003 and went on to complete her Masters in European Union Law in the same university in 2004. Jennifer completed her traineeship with the Legal Aid Board in Dublin where she specialised in the area of family law before joining Augustus Cullen Law in June 2009. Jennifer is currently completing her Diploma in Employment Law in the Law Society of Ireland.
Since joining Augustus Cullen Law, Jennifer practices in the litigation department and her practice areas encompass a wide range of legal issues with an emphasis on employment law, professional negligence and family law matters. Jennifer continues to specialise in family law and the provision of a comprehensive family law service to clients at all levels whether in the District, Circuit or High Court to include Guardianship, Maintenance & Access Matters, Negotiation of Separation Agreements, Judicial Separation, Divorce and Civil Partnership.
